/**
* Utility class for AMRMClient.
*/
@Private
public final class AMRMClientUtils {
private static final Logger LOG =
LoggerFactory.getLogger(AMRMClientUtils.class);
public static final String APP_ALREADY_REGISTERED_MESSAGE =
"Application Master is already registered : ";
private AMRMClientUtils() {
}
/**
* Handle ApplicationNotRegistered exception and re-register.
*
* @param attemptId app attemptId
* @param rmProxy RM proxy instance
* @param registerRequest the AM re-register request
* @throws YarnException if re-register fails
*/
public static void handleNotRegisteredExceptionAndReRegister(
ApplicationAttemptId attemptId, ApplicationMasterProtocol rmProxy,
RegisterApplicationMasterRequest registerRequest) throws YarnException {
LOG.info("App attempt {} not registered, most likely due to RM failover. "
+ " Trying to re-register.", attemptId);
try {
rmProxy.registerApplicationMaster(registerRequest);
} catch (Exception e) {
if (e instanceof InvalidApplicationMasterRequestException
&& e.getMessage().contains(APP_ALREADY_REGISTERED_MESSAGE)) {
LOG.info("Concurrent thread successfully registered, moving on.");
} else {
LOG.error("Error trying to re-register AM", e);
throw new YarnException(e);
}
}
}
/**
* Helper method for client calling ApplicationMasterProtocol.allocate that
* handles re-register if RM fails over.
*
* @param request allocate request
* @param rmProxy RM proxy
* @param registerRequest the register request for re-register
* @param attemptId application attempt id
* @return allocate response
* @throws YarnException if RM call fails
* @throws IOException if RM call fails
*/
public static AllocateResponse allocateWithReRegister(AllocateRequest request,
ApplicationMasterProtocol rmProxy,
RegisterApplicationMasterRequest registerRequest,
ApplicationAttemptId attemptId) throws YarnException, IOException {
try {
return rmProxy.allocate(request);
} catch (ApplicationMasterNotRegisteredException e) {
handleNotRegisteredExceptionAndReRegister(attemptId, rmProxy,
registerRequest);
// reset responseId after re-register
request.setResponseId(0);
// retry allocate
return allocateWithReRegister(request, rmProxy, registerRequest,
attemptId);
}
}
/**
* Helper method for client calling
* ApplicationMasterProtocol.finishApplicationMaster that handles re-register
* if RM fails over.
*
* @param request finishApplicationMaster request
* @param rmProxy RM proxy
* @param registerRequest the register request for re-register
* @param attemptId application attempt id
* @return finishApplicationMaster response
* @throws YarnException if RM call fails
* @throws IOException if RM call fails
*/
public static FinishApplicationMasterResponse finishAMWithReRegister(
FinishApplicationMasterRequest request, ApplicationMasterProtocol rmProxy,
RegisterApplicationMasterRequest registerRequest,
ApplicationAttemptId attemptId) throws YarnException, IOException {
try {
return rmProxy.finishApplicationMaster(request);
} catch (ApplicationMasterNotRegisteredException ex) {
handleNotRegisteredExceptionAndReRegister(attemptId, rmProxy,
registerRequest);
// retry finishAM after re-register
return finishAMWithReRegister(request, rmProxy, registerRequest,
attemptId);
}
}
/**
* Create a proxy for the specified protocol.
*
* @param configuration Configuration to generate {@link ClientRMProxy}
* @param protocol Protocol for the proxy
* @param user the user on whose behalf the proxy is being created
* @param token the auth token to use for connection
* @param <T> Type information of the proxy
* @return Proxy to the RM
* @throws IOException on failure
*/
@Public
@Unstable
public static <T> T createRMProxy(final Configuration configuration,
final Class<T> protocol, UserGroupInformation user,
final Token<? extends TokenIdentifier> token) throws IOException {
try {
String rmClusterId = configuration.get(YarnConfiguration.RM_CLUSTER_ID,
YarnConfiguration.DEFAULT_RM_CLUSTER_ID);
LOG.info("Creating RMProxy to RM {} for protocol {} for user {}",
rmClusterId, protocol.getSimpleName(), user);
if (token != null) {
token.setService(ClientRMProxy.getAMRMTokenService(configuration));
user.addToken(token);
setAuthModeInConf(configuration);
}
final T proxyConnection = user.doAs(new PrivilegedExceptionAction<T>() {
@Override
public T run() throws Exception {
return ClientRMProxy.createRMProxy(configuration, protocol);
}
});
return proxyConnection;
} catch (InterruptedException e) {
throw new YarnRuntimeException(e);
}
}
private static void setAuthModeInConf(Configuration conf) {
conf.set(CommonConfigurationKeysPublic.HADOOP_SECURITY_AUTHENTICATION,
SaslRpcServer.AuthMethod.TOKEN.toString());
}
}
